Why Live in Warner

Warner, a town in New Hampshire, features a mix of housing options, from fixer-uppers in the forested hillsides to historic 1800s cabins and modern farmhouses. Homes range from $150,000 to over $1 million, with styles including ranch, Cape Cod, Colonial Revival, and rustic log cabins. The area is known for its agritourism, with family farms offering grass-fed beef, berry picking, and lavender wreath-making at Pumpkin Blossom Farms.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y Riverside Park along the Warner River, the Warner Rail Trail, and hiking at Rollins State Park. Historical sites include the New Hampshire Telephone Museum and the Upton Chandler House Museum. East Main Street, the town's main thoroughfare, hosts a variety of shops and restaurants, such as The Local and Charlie Mac's Pizzeria, as well as community events at Jim Mitchell Community Park. The Warner Fall Foliage Festival is a long-standing tradition celebrating the harvest season. Warner lacks public transportation, so residents rely on driving, with Concord 22 miles east and Manchester 36 miles southeast. The Kearsarge Regional School District serves the area, with Simonds Elementary, Kearsarge Regional Middle, and Kearsarge Regional High School all receiving solid ratings.
